Photo by Hideki Yamagata
Find hotels in Oskaloosa, IA from ฿1,640
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Go beyond your typical stay in Oskaloosa
Pet friendly
Check prices for these dates
Our top choices for Oskaloosa hotels

9.4 out of 10, Exceptional, (229)
The price is ฿3,993
฿4,472 total
includes taxes & fees
18 Jan - 19 Jan

8.2 out of 10, Very good, (662)

8.6 out of 10, Excellent, (248)
The price is ฿1,655
฿2,075 total
includes taxes & fees
3 Feb - 4 Feb
The price is ฿1,849
฿2,071 total
includes taxes & fees
11 Jan - 12 Jan

5.0 out of 10, (151)
The price is ฿1,351
฿1,640 total
includes taxes & fees
18 Jan - 19 Jan












































